New Drama 'Good Woman Busami' Debuts with Intrigue and Mystery

On the first episode released on the 29th, the Genie TV original 'Good Woman Busami' showcased the intense backstory of Kim Young-ran, played by Jeon Yeo-bin, as she becomes the personal bodyguard of Ga Sung-ho, the chairman of Ga Sung Group, portrayed by Moon Sung-keun. The episode recorded a nationwide viewership of 2.4% and 2.3% in the metropolitan area, making it the highest-rated first episode among Genie TV originals, according to Nielsen Korea.

Ga Sung-ho, who observed the interview via CCTV, becomes intrigued by Kim Young-ran's desperate demeanor and decides to hire her, offering her a chance to escape her troubled past.
On her first day as Ga Sung-ho's bodyguard, Kim Young-ran uncovers suspicious activities within the Ga Sung Group's mansion, including hidden cameras and the revelation that Ga Sung-ho's biological daughter was murdered.

Kim Young-ran, contemplating the possibility of a murder-for-hire request, asks Ga Sung-ho, "What would you like me to do?" To her surprise, Ga Sung-ho proposes marriage instead, leaving viewers curious about his true intentions.
'Good Woman Busami' captivates audiences with its fast-paced narrative of Kim Young-ran's journey into the Ga Sung Group. The drama's unique characters and their intertwined goals create a thrilling atmosphere within the confines of the Ga Sung mansion.
The stellar performances led by Jeon Yeo-bin and the suspenseful direction and cinematography by director Park Yoo-young enhance the drama's appeal. The well-crafted script, unraveling the secrets of the Ga Sung Group, keeps viewers engaged and eager for the next episode.
